About

Laurie Day is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Clinical Psychology and Education. According to data from OpenAlex, Laurie Day has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 412 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in General Health Professions, 5 papers in Clinical Psychology and 5 papers in Education. Recurrent topics in Laurie Day's work include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ers), Education Systems and Policy (4 papers) and Youth Education and Societal Dynamics (3 papers). Laurie Day is often cited by papers focused on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ers), Education Systems and Policy (4 papers) and Youth Education and Societal Dynamics (3 papers). Laurie Day coll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Italy. Laurie Day's co-authors include Monika Ardelt, Brian R. Flay, Donald Hedeker, Ohidul Siddiqui, Mary Rogers Gillmore, Frank B. Hu, Richard F. Catalano, J. David Hawkins, Michelle Miller and Tonda L. Hughes and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Consulting and Clinical Psychology, American Journal of Preventive Medicine and BMJ Open.
